As our internal phone system is voip with a asterisk PBX I simply setup a time condition after hours for them to either leave a message or press 6 if they believe a tower is down, or its an emergency to forward the call to my cell. Ryan On Thu, Apr 16, 2009 at 7:42 PM, Aaron D. Osgood < aosg...@s
